Significance of Fascia Boards
Fascia boards serve several vital functions that contribute to the longevity and performance of a structure.
Security: They protect the underlying structure from wetness intrusion, bugs, and the components.Support: They support the lower edges of the roof, including the roofing shingles and sheathing.Aesthetic Appeal: Fascia boards contribute substantially to the overall appearance of a structure, helping to produce a polished and finished appearance.Indications It's Time for Replacement

When considering replacement fascias, various materials offer varying advantages and downsides. Comprehending these alternatives can assist homeowners make informed choices. Below is a breakdown of common materials:
MaterialAdvantagesDrawbacksWoodAesthetic appeal, natural appearanceHigh maintenance, susceptible to rotVinylLow maintenance, resistant to moistureCan fade over time, limited color choicesAluminumResilient, fire-resistantMay damage or scratch, less visual varietyFiber CementExceptionally resilient, mimics wood appearanceHeavier, can be more costlyPVCExtremely resistant to weather and rotGreater in advance expense, might look less naturalThe Replacement Process

How frequently should fascia boards be changed?
Fascia boards can last anywhere from 10 to 50 years depending upon the material and maintenance. Routine inspections can indicate when replacements are required.
2. Can I paint my fascia boards?
Yes, painting is an exceptional way to secure wooden fascia boards from moisture while improving curb appeal.
3. What is the best material for fascia boards?
The very best material depends on the property and personal preference. Vinyl is popular for its low maintenance, while wood is preferred for its visual appeal.
4. Can I change fascia boards in winter season?
While it is possible to replace fascia boards in winter, moderate temperatures are more favorable for working with various materials and ensuring proper adhesion and sealing.
